The problem nail salons face every day
Nail salons miss roughly 48% <!-- source: https://martech.health/articles/how-many-phone-calls-are-you-missing-see-how-your-industry-stacks-up --> of inbound booking calls during peak hours because techs are at the table and owners can't answer with a polish brush in hand. The result is a leaky bucket: a quarter of your marketing spend pays for calls that go unanswered, and 85% of those callers never call back <!-- source: https://www.numa.com/blog/22-business-phone-statistics -->. Hiring a second receptionist costs $44,000 to $60,000 <!-- source: https://schedulingkit.com/blog/ai-vs-human-receptionist-cost-comparison --> fully loaded for coverage that still ends at 5 p.m. Traditional answering services pick up the phone, but they read scripts, can't see your schedule, and book the wrong things into the wrong slots. The math is brutal: you're losing $40 to $90 <!-- source: https://www.airtasker.com/us/costs/manicure/manicure-cost/ --> in average ticket per missed booking every time a prospect calls and gets sent to voicemail, and your team is too busy serving the customers in front of them to dig out. The phone ends up running the business — instead of the business running the phone.
